What I can gather is that you have Necora's Pine Set; Natural Diversity; Crystal Cliffs; and Maritimes Storage, which are all above CC.

From what I can see in your screenshot "trapper probs" is that you don't have a Pine Forester with your Trapper, which is why your Trapper isn't producing any products.  You need the Forester to plant the Pine Trees, which produce the items that the Trapper collects.

When you first started your map, when you cleared the area, did you clear any of the Trapper items?
Were they only 'normal' items that you collected when clearing the land?
Did you clear anything and have Domesticated Animals drop?

  as for this trapper. i have tested it with forests, both pine and maple, in the forests after many years he does get better numbers after the forests mature. that is like 8 years plus.if you check the pics, the main reason i did put him there is to deal with the beavers. the laborers would destroy the lodges but never collect anything.he has been there for several years and gets about 8 pelts a year.sometimes he does find duck eggs also. i did think he would trap foxes and rabbits too. yes i won't get the numbers that i would with a forest but i would get something. i am surprised the last year he got 0.
   in the pic,u can see other foods on the ground that nobody is harvesting either.i cleared trees and rocks. late winter/early spring of year 24, i did send workers to clear just thatch.the hope was by doing that the fodder would produce more. the fodder mod is below CC in mod order but that should not mess with it. before RED's last update to it, i would set it so half the cirlce was over a lake. it would produce fodder so fast it would keep hitting the limit.reset limit and again i would hit it.by doing that it would shut down the fertilizer process. with 1 worker on 1 fodder, i would have enough for 2 stables with 1 worker each and like 4 greenhouses.it was overpowered.now i can't keep 1 stable supplied with fodder. i am getting less than 200 fodder.
   with the testing i have done with it,i decided to start it early and clear trees and rocks. thatch is cleared and a worker is taking care of the flowers.there is no ideas left to boost the fodder except add a 2nd worker.but everyone living in the meadow have jobs and are busy.
  the other thing i have noticed is there is no re-growth of anything inside the for. that area was cleared of trees and rocks within the first 5 years.so almost 20 years later and nothing has grown back up. there is some thatch but only near the road foing between the bridges.it isnt very thick either.before the NAT DIV mod, my trees would grow really thick and i would have had to reclear that area several times.

  i didn't mean to confuse ,QUERY.i do think the fodder mod has to be moved above CC.that will at least help the well produce better. there is a known issue with the NAT DIV that causes trees not to regrow. my maps have never had all the forests die off.though the immportal tree mod will stop them from dying,it will not help the trees respawn or multiply.this quirk is both good and bad. the map would look strange if all the trees die except the forests.however, it means less decorating has to be done to stop trees from overgrowing villages and towns.my idea is the trapper hangs at the beekeeper too much.
   some of those mod issues have been fixed and updated.to clarify how this is a 1.06 and a half,banished is updated to 1.07,CC is updated. a few 1.07 mods are added. the majority of my mods are still 1.06.i did this for several reasons. when the community group came out,i started a folder for the upgaded mods. i was used to where things are so i kept playing the old way. when the new tree,fodder,and texture mods came out i upgraded the game to 1.07.with charcoal conflicts between CC and the pine set,i upped the CC.i am sure there are more glitches than i know by playing this way.even an oil press will have a conflict.once this game is done,i will have to refigure my entire mod set. that will take some time. with so many mods,it is frustrating to re shuffle them like a deck of cards. always seems to be 1 or 2 that either don't get moved perfectly or there is an unknown conflict.there are still tons of mods not yet updated and banished expands faster.
